Can You Live a Long Life with a Stoma?

Stomas are artificial openings created in the abdominal wall that allow waste to be removed from the body.

They are typically created as an alternative method for waste removal for those who have had treatments or surgeries related to medical conditions such as inflammatory bowel disease, colorectal cancer, and bladder cancer.

Despite the physical implications of having a stoma, it is possible to live a long and healthy life if you manage your condition properly.

Medical Conditions That Lead to a Stoma

Inflammatory Bowel Disease (IBD) is an umbrella term used to refer to multiple debilitating gastrointestinal disorders that cause inflammation in the digestive tract.

The two main types of IBD are Crohn’s disease and ulcerative colitis, both of which can lead to the formation of a stoma in order to remove bodily waste.

Colorectal cancer is another type of malignant tumor that often requires surgery. In some cases, surgery may result in the creation of an ostomy.

Exploring Life Expectancy

The life expectancy of someone living with a stoma will depend on various factors such as age, overall health and the severity of the underlying medical condition.

It is not directly connected with the stoma. Generally speaking, however, people who undergo stoma procedures can expect similar life expectancy rates compared to people without a stoma.

Also, newer techniques and advanced medical technology can improve quality of life and make living with a stoma more manageable over time.

Addressing Common Concerns

Managing pouching systems is one common concern among many people living with a stoma—fortunately there are odor control products available that help keep odors at bay while wearing them throughout everyday activities like work or social events.

Some people find that certain foods trigger odors more than others; avoiding these triggers can greatly reduce any potential issues related to odor control while out and about with your pouching system attached.

Another important factor is wearing clothes comfortable enough so as not to interfere with regular functions involving your pouching system throughout the day.
